Being a single mother: possible treatments with donor sperm

More and more women are single mothers by choice. In Spain, a woman can have a child without a partner thanks to pregnancy through techniques of assisted reproduction with semen donation or adoption.

To achieve pregnancy, donor semen is used, either in artificial insemination or in vitro fertilization. If necessary, ovules from a donor or the adoption of embryos can also be used.

The reproductive center specialist will request a female fertility test to decide the most appropriate treatment for each particular case.

Home insemination

The homemade insemination consists of the woman inseminating in her house, with the semen of a donor that she has bought from an accredited semen bank. It is a very popular method that single women can use to have a child.

It is important that the woman take into account that this is not an assisted reproduction technique, since it is not carried out with intervention or medical assistance.

Therefore, the probability of pregnancy is similar to that of a natural pregnancy and will depend both on whether it is performed at the right time and on the correct handling of the sample.

Artificial insemination for single mothers

A woman can be a single mother by artificial insemination with donor sperm (IAD) in an assisted reproduction center. To do this, you must have a good ovarian reserve and the fallopian tubes must allow the passage of the sperm for the fertilization of the ovule.

The steps will be the following:

  • Soft ovarian stimulation by hormonal medication
  • Ultrasound and estrogen analysis to assess the maturation of the ovules
  • Induction of ovulation with hormonal medication
  • Introduction of semen into the uterus through a cannula

The semen will be from an anonymous donor, as required by Spanish legislation in assisted reproduction treatments. The fertility clinic will be responsible for choosing a donor whose physical and immunological characteristics are as similar as possible to those of the woman.

Adoption of embryos

It is a cheaper alternative to the double donation of gametes. It is an option available when a woman can not use her own eggs to have a child.

This reproductive method consists in using the surplus embryos from in vitro fertilization treatments of other women or couples.

These are frozen in liquid nitrogen, so you simply have to thaw them and transfer them to the uterus. The process would be the following:

  • Preparation of the endometrium with hormonal medication
  • Defrosting of embryos
  • Embryo transfer to the woman's uterus

As with the donation of oocytes and semen, the donation is anonymous. The fertility center chooses the embryos based on the immunological and physical characteristics of the couple or woman who has donated them to match those of the future mother.
